Output d97eed9bbb4a0dcdbeb61c48948b269d30d21fdaf04bb37f8df2d4e87efaebf3:0

value
685938
script pubkey
OP_0 OP_PUSHBYTES_20 8b530505ad03d526cfb810504cb0a5799ebfd97f
address
bc1q3dfs2pddq02jdnaczpgyev990x0tlktlayv98d
transaction
d97eed9bbb4a0dcdbeb61c48948b269d30d21fdaf04bb37f8df2d4e87efaebf3
confirmations
179452
spent
true